Ofwat has today confirmed the implementation of commitments from Thames Water, effective immediately, to remedy its licence breach in losing its investment grade credit ratings - including a commitment to further develop a revised AMP8 Business Plan for the period 1 April 2024 to 31 March 2030 by 28 August 2024.
Fitch Ratings has downgraded the credit ratings of Thames Water’s holding company Kemble Water Finance Ltd and revised its Issuer Default Rating to Negative, reflecting pressure on Kemble's and Thames Water’s financial profiles as a result of Ofwat’s challenging Final Determination on the company’s AMP7 business plan.
